On Wed, 2010-11-10 at 08:46 -0500, B. Alexander wrote:
> I checked and apparently it is getting an ALRM signal because it is
> timing out. However, I do not understand why it is taking 20 hours to
> back up this small amount of data. My $Conf{ClientTimeout} = 72000;
> and the data that is being backed up is:
> 
> 49M   /boot
> 142M  /lib/modules
> 148M  /home
> 5.8M  /etc
> 6.7M  /var/backups
> 93M   /var/cache/apt
> 139M  /var/lib/apt
> 25M   /var/lib/dpkg
> 12M   /root
> 15M   /var/log
> 49M   /usr/local

One thing I do to identify a file causing problems with a backup is to
use the "tree" command (see your package manager) on the running backup:

cd /var/lib/backuppc/pc/HOSTNAME
tree NEW

The last file will be the file currently backing up.
